An interest in the dynamic behavior of railway bridges subjected to high-speed trains in Indonesia increased within the construction of the first high-speed railway. Under high-speed trains, with speeds over 200 km/h, the dynamic effect has often been shown to be the governing parameter of bridge design, therefore a dynamic analysis is required. This paper presents a dynamic analysis of a simply supported railway bridge due to high-speed trains through moving axle loads using finite element models. The influence parameters of train and bridges i.e., train speeds, train loading configurations, and bridge span length on the dynamic responses of railway bridges is investigated. The effect of the delay time between entries of the trains on the double-track bridge is also examined. From the analysis, the dynamic responses of the railway bridge in terms of accelerations, deformations, and moments were obtained, and the critical or resonant speed over the speed range was identified. Dynamic amplification factors (DAF) are also determined from the dynamic responses and compared to current standards. Using the findings from this study, the influence of certain parameters on the dynamic behavior of high-speed railway bridges can be determined particularly for the preliminary design stages.
